BUS services across the New Forest were hit again today as drivers went on strike.
Wilts and Dorset services running in Lyndhurst, Lymington or Brockenhurst were affected as a result of the dispute.
It is the second in a series of strikes in a long-running row over hours drivers spend behind the wheel.
Six Wilts and Dorset depots will be hit by the walkouts also due to take place on January 16 and 21.
The dispute hits services in areas including Bournemouth, Poole, New Forest and Swanage although the company's depot in Salisbury is not affected.
The Rail Maritime and Transport union said its 375 members at the company had voted twice to go on strike in protest at ''excessive'' working hours.
